Security

Private and local by default

Sessions record on your Mac. Nothing leaves the machine until you connect your organization

You choose what syncs. Connect your organization to share sessions, or keep a project local to just you

You choose the audience. A flag routes to this session, one team, or the whole org, and history shows who saw what
